📝 Perovskite Solar Panels[1]

🚀 A new type of solar cell made using perovskite-structured materials that absorb sunlight very efficiently ⇒ Seen as a major alternative to traditional silicon solar panels.

Advantages: Higher efficiency, lower production Cost, lower weight and more flexibility.

⚠️ Challenges: Shorter lifespan, toxicity (lead), and recycling issues (harmful solvents).

🚀 Way Forward:

👉🏽 New water-based recycling methods, using safe salts such as sodium acetate and sodium iodide, are showing promise to recover almost 99% of materials without toxic solvents.

👉🏽 Research is ongoing to create perovskite cells without lead, using safer materials.

👉🏽 Coatings and hybrid designs are being developed to enhance the longevity of perovskite cells.

💡Perovskite: A crystal with ABX₃ structure that absorbs sunlight super-efficiently, helping to create cheaper and smarter solar panels for the future.

👉🏽 A and B refer to positively charged particles, while X refers to a negatively charged particle.

📝 M23 Rebels[2]

🚀 A Rwanda-backed rebel paramilitary group based in the eastern regions of the Democratic Republic of the Congo (DRC) ⇒ A member of the Congo River Alliance, a coalition of rebel groups in eastern DRC.

👉🏽 Recently, the DRC suspended the political party of former President Joseph Kabila, the People’s Party for Reconstruction and Democracy (PPRD), accusing it of supporting the M23 rebels.

📝 2025 Hindu Kush Himalaya Snow Update[3][4][5]

🚀 A report released by the International Centre for Integrated Mountain Development (ICIMOD).

👉🏽 Snow persistence over the Hindu Kush Himalaya region between November and March this year was 23.6% below normal levels ⇒ A record low in the last 23 years.

👉🏽 Snow persistence in the Ganga basin this year has been 24.1% below normal ⇒ It was 30.2% above normal in 2015.

👉🏽 Mekong region51.9% decline in snow persistence ⇒ Most alarming.

❄️ Snow persistence measures the fraction of time snow remains on the ground after snowfall.

🌊 Snowmelt contributes about 23% to the total yearly water flow in major river basins.

💡ICIMOD: An intergovernmental knowledge and learning centre based in Kathmandu ⇒ Founded in 1983 ⇒ Aims to secure a greener, more inclusive, and climate-resilient Hindu Kush Himalaya (HKH).

👉🏽 8 member countries: Afghanistan, Bangladesh, Bhutan, China, India, Myanmar, Nepal, and Pakistan.

💡Hindu Kush Himalaya (HKH): Extends 3,500 km over 8 eight member countries of ICIMOD ⇒ Source of 10 large Asian river systems: Amu Darya, Indus, Ganges, Brahmaputra, Irrawaddy, Salween, Mekong, Yangtse, Yellow River, and Tarim.

📝 SpaDeX Mission[7][8][9]

🚀 Refers to the Space Docking Experiment by ISRO ⇒ To demonstrate the technology needed for rendezvous, docking, and undocking of two small spacecraft named SDX01 (Chaser) and SDX02 (Target) in a low-Earth circular orbit.

👉🏽 Launched using PSLV-C60 on 30 December 2024 ⇒ Satellites were docked for the 1st time on 16 January 2025 2nd docking took place on April 20, 2025.

👉🏽 Applications: Human spaceflight, in-space satellite servicing and other proximity operations

📝 Eight Core Industries of India[10]

🚀 Includes cement, fertilisers, steel, electricity, coal, refinery products, natural gas, and crude oil40.27% of the weight of items included in the Index of Industrial Production.

🚀 Index of Eight Core Industries: Recorded 4.4% growth in FY25 compared to FY24.
